Well, I only run on Windows, so that's not the problem... Since it
works for me, I'd really need to know more details:
* which versions of Java, Eclipse, Erlang and Erlide you are running
* if you start eclipse adding arguments
-vm "C:/path/to/java.exe" -consoleLog
you will get more info on the console. Please attach the output.
